Two bitten by fox in Southern Pines

Moore County Sheriff Ronnie Fields reports in a news advisory that on Saturday, July 5, Animal Services deputies were dispatched to a fox bite incident on Duncan Road near May Street in Southern Pines.

Upon arrival, deputies spoke with a female victim who reported being bitten by a fox while running along Duncan Road. Despite an extensive search, the animal was not located.

On Monday, July 7, deputies responded to a second fox-related incident on Crestview Road, also in Southern Pines. A woman was reportedly attacked while trying to protect her pet from an aggressive fox. During the altercation, the woman was able to kill the fox…
